Can someone post a quick way to do this? Tomorrow I'm going to a virtual reality lab at a nearby college campus and the guy I talked to said the files he uses are .3ds. I know I can get my shotgun to a .3ds file somehow, but don't know the way. Any ideas?

Duh, you export as PSK with the actorX plugin for XSI and then you unwrap3d to open the PSK........you'll need o download the PSK plugin from Unwrap3d site......all extra plugins are not included.....

Also, I think you cannot save with Unwrap3d demo........


Other option is to use Milkshaoe3d to open DotXSI
 
To export as SMD you have to use the 'ValveSource' menu at the top. If it's not there you need to install it, it's in the SDK content or download the add-on from the softimage website
